Transaction 329af27ea15040a6b30be5266126a27889034963f6bc0384534e4765689d7469

1 Input
2 Outputs
  • 329af27ea15040a6b30be5266126a27889034963f6bc0384534e4765689d7469:0
  • value  336000
    address  39QUet2qxN5b6CLnoTVm8vmcixpNbFZDYX
  • 329af27ea15040a6b30be5266126a27889034963f6bc0384534e4765689d7469:1
  • value  7009818
    address  1M8xqyTbSSFEZJ6dyLkHUNZFppYpywEowu